Jeff Kuhner, Dwight Schultz (similar voices, opinions)

Jeff Kuhner of WTNT and the Washington Times and actor Dwight Schultz (A Team) have done fill ins for
various hosts. Both have similar voices (a Schultz fansite said some people thought they had heard
Schultz filling in for Michael Savage but they may have been hearing Kuhner instead). Both are
right wing, tell-it-like-it-is talkers on subjects like terrorism. My guess is that people will NOT mix up
Dwight Schultz with Ed Schultz despite the surnames...and Kuhner took pride in noting that he knocked
Ed Schultz of WTNT. He hopes to be nationally syndicated (of course many other hosts have also
wished that, too)
